The Database Experts' Guide to Database 2

Rate this book
This first volume in the Database Experts' Series uses real-world systems experience to explain IBM's new mainframe relational database — Database 2. written for a computer-literate audience — programmers, database administrators, and others with previous database experience in mainframe computing — this is the first book to provide in-depth coverage and instruction in Database 2. IBM hopes to have all its mainframe customers converted to Database 2 by 1992 and this valuable guide is a "must-have" for the thousands of developers who must learn to design and implement its applications.

442 pages, Hardcover

Published June 1, 1988
